結果

問題 No.313 π
ユーザー mannshi222mannshi222
提出日時 2019-07-10 17:38:34
言語 C
(gcc 12.3.0)
結果
AC  
実行時間 3 ms / 5,000 ms
コード長 1,268 bytes
コンパイル時間 812 ms
コンパイル使用メモリ 29,568 KB
実行使用メモリ 5,248 KB
最終ジャッジ日時 2024-10-15 17:16:11
合計ジャッジ時間 2,470 ms
ジャッジサーバーID
(参考情報)
judge3 / judge2
このコードへのチャレンジ
(要ログイン)

テストケース

テストケース表示
入力 結果 実行時間
実行使用メモリ
testcase_00 AC 2 ms
5,248 KB
testcase_01 AC 2 ms
5,248 KB
testcase_02 AC 2 ms
5,248 KB
testcase_03 AC 2 ms
5,248 KB
testcase_04 AC 2 ms
5,248 KB
testcase_05 AC 2 ms
5,248 KB
testcase_06 AC 2 ms
5,248 KB
testcase_07 AC 2 ms
5,248 KB
testcase_08 AC 2 ms
5,248 KB
testcase_09 AC 2 ms
5,248 KB
testcase_10 AC 2 ms
5,248 KB
testcase_11 AC 2 ms
5,248 KB
testcase_12 AC 2 ms
5,248 KB
testcase_13 AC 2 ms
5,248 KB
testcase_14 AC 2 ms
5,248 KB
testcase_15 AC 2 ms
5,248 KB
testcase_16 AC 2 ms
5,248 KB
testcase_17 AC 2 ms
5,248 KB
testcase_18 AC 3 ms
5,248 KB
testcase_19 AC 2 ms
5,248 KB
testcase_20 AC 2 ms
5,248 KB
testcase_21 AC 2 ms
5,248 KB
testcase_22 AC 2 ms
5,248 KB
testcase_23 AC 2 ms
5,248 KB
testcase_24 AC 2 ms
5,248 KB
testcase_25 AC 2 ms
5,248 KB
testcase_26 AC 2 ms
5,248 KB
testcase_27 AC 2 ms
5,248 KB
testcase_28 AC 2 ms
5,248 KB
testcase_29 AC 2 ms
5,248 KB
testcase_30 AC 2 ms
5,248 KB
testcase_31 AC 2 ms
5,248 KB
testcase_32 AC 2 ms
5,248 KB
testcase_33 AC 2 ms
5,248 KB
権限があれば一括ダウンロードができます

ソースコード

diff #

#include <stdio.h>

int  main() {
        int inputc;
        int sum[10]  = { 0,0,0,0,0,0,0,0,0,0 };
        int answer[10];
        int counter;
answer[0] = 20104;
answer[1] = 20063;
answer[2] = 19892;
answer[3] = 20011;
answer[4] = 19874;
answer[5] = 20199;
answer[6] = 19898;
answer[7] = 20163;
answer[8] = 19956;
answer[9] = 19841;
        int err, ans;


        inputc = getc(stdin);
        sum[inputc-48]++;
        getc(stdin);
        counter = 0 ;;
        while( (inputc = getc(stdin) )!= EOF ) {
                counter++;
                if( inputc=='\n' ) {
                        break;
                }
                if( counter > 200000 ) {
                        continue;
                }
                sum[inputc-48]++;
        }
#ifdef DBG
        for( int i=0; i<10; i++ ) {
                printf("[%d]\n %d %d\n", i, sum[i], answer[i]);
        }
#endif
        for( int i=0; i< 10; i++ ) {
                if(sum[i]!=answer[i]){
                        if( sum[i] > answer[i] ) {
                                err = i;
                        }
                        else {
                                ans = i;
                        }
                }
        }

        printf("%d %d\n", err, ans);


        return 0;
}
0